Had a power failure at my office today. The other 9 or so computers are fine in the office but mine will not boot properly.
XP home/Hp pavilion 1.7
It boots in safe mode & safe with networking
It will not boot to last known good config.
Not booting in Normal mode but it does flash a blue error screen prior to going black. Can't read the screen it is too fast.
Tried a clean boot using MSCONFIG and removing all unnecessary pgms etc.
Still not booting in normal mode.
Tried a restore to last checkpoint, Mid - January
Still not booting in normal mode.
Because of all the files and programs installed on this machine the last thing I want to do is re-install XP.
Also in the Windows folder a 64K Dump###.tmp file is being created with each attempted boot. Opened in notepad, can't decipher. Any way to trap the error or format the dump file?
Thanks in advance for your help.
